  • Patent number: 9015952
    Abstract: The six direction directing device includes a shaft, a rotation member, a driving source, and a guide member. The shaft extends in an X axis direction. The rotation member is rotatable around an inclined axis inclined at ? deg with respect to the shaft. The rotation member has an xyz rectangular coordinate system. The rotation member further includes a spherical surface and an orbit portion formed around an x axis of the spherical surface. The guide member is fixed to an XYZ rectangular coordinate system. The orbit portion has such a shape that the y axis of the rotation member is sequentially directed in + and ? directions on the U, V, and W axes that cross one another at intervals of 60 deg around the X axis when the rotation member is rotated in contact with the guide member by the rotation of the shaft.

  • Patent number: 8528220
    Abstract: A six-direction indicator is provided in an XYZ rectangular coordinate system and includes a shaft on an X axis, a rotation member rotatable around an axis inclined with respect to a rotation axis, guide pins provided upright on the rotation member, and a guide member provided around the X-axis to surround the rotation member. The guide member has a zigzag slit track bent alternately in a mountain-like shape and a valley-like shape in the X direction at intervals of 60° around the X-axis. The guide pins are inserted in the slit track and move around on the slit track by rotation of the shaft. The device indicates one of the positive and negative directions on the U, V, and W axes crossing one another at intervals of 60° around the X-axis.
